NSW Waratahs and New Zealand Blues to clash in Women's Super Rugby Champions Final
The NSW Waratahs will host New Zealand's Blues at Leichhardt Oval in Sydney for the Women’s Super Rugby Champions Final. The Waratahs, three‑time Super Rugby Women champions, earned their place by defeating the Fijian Drua in the Grand Final, while the Blues arrived as three‑peat winners of New Zealand’s Super Rugby Aupiki competition.
The match is a repeat of last year’s inaugural cross‑Tasman showdown, which the Blues won 36‑5 in Auckland. Waratahs head coach Mike Ruthven said his side has a different mindset this time, aiming to reverse the previous result. Winger Amelia Whitaker has been promoted to the starting lineup after Desiree Miller was ruled out with a calf injury, and Lusiana Vesikula joins the bench as the only other change.
The Blues have also made adjustments due to injuries, inserting hooker Grace Gago and bringing back Eloise Blackwell among others. Both teams will look to claim the inaugural Champions Final title in front of a home crowd.
